Town
Pelt is a municipality in the Belgian province of . It arose on 1 January 2019 from the merging of the municipalities of Neerpelt and . After Neerpelt and had previously agreed in principle to a merger, the new name of the municipality was announced on 4 November 2017 after a local referendum on the question.
